What BMW has an app?

For which BMW models is the My BMW App available? The My BMW App is optimised for vehicles built from 2014 onwards. The availability of individual app functions depends on your vehicle equipment and your BMW ConnectedDrive contract. To create a new BMW ID, select Register on the login page of the My BMW App or the My BMW portal. Enter your login data and personal details and save your input by clicking on Register now. To complete your registration, you will receive an e-mail with a confirmation link.Your BMW ID is your central login for all offers relating to the BMW brand and the use of BMW ConnectedDrive. The personal data and settings for your BMW ID are stored in the BMW Cloud and synchronised in your BMW with Operating System 7 or newer, in the My BMW App and in the My BMW portal.

What is BMW full form?

BMW is the acronym everyone uses to describe the world-renowned car brand. The full name, Bayerische Motoren Werke – or Bavarian Motor Works – is a bit of a mouthful after all (➜ Read more: The BMW name and its history). Bimmer,” “beamer” and “beemer” are all common nicknames for BMW vehicles.The nickname “bimmer” for BMW cars originated in the US. It was derived from “beemer” or “beamer,” names for BMW motorcycles that were first coined in the UK in the 1960s and later spread across the globe.

What does “M” mean in BMW models?

Originally designed for BMW’s racing and rallying teams, the BMW M division stands for ‘Motorsport’ and represents the German manufacturer’s highest performing cars. M Models often feature dramatic upgrades to their engines, transmissions, suspensions, and brakes, as well as various other performance enhancements.
